Common signs of adhd

  • Inattention and difficulty focusing
  • Impulsivity and difficulty waiting for turns
  • Hyperactivity and restlessness
  • Difficulty organizing tasks and activities
  • Forgetfulness in daily activities

Coping strategies that may help

Establish a Routine

Creating a consistent daily routine can help provide structure and minimize distractions.

Break Tasks into Smaller Steps

Dividing larger tasks into manageable chunks can make them feel less overwhelming and easier to accomplish.

Use Visual Reminders

Visual aids like calendars, to-do lists, or sticky notes can help keep important tasks and appointments in mind.

Practice Mindfulness Techniques

Engaging in mindfulness exercises can help improve focus and reduce impulsivity by fostering a sense of calm.
